Silicon Valley Chinese Association Foundation (incorporated in 2015) is holding a competition this summer to develop open-source AI-driven solutions that will enable citizens to engage with different parts of the legislative process. SVCAF is a nonprofit grassroots organization aiming to educate and activate the national Chinese community in public affairs and public policy.

The seminar will feature current leaders in the use of AI in legislation to speak about current AI- or tech-based projects that interact with legislation. We will also be providing more information about participating in or supporting the competition itself. Each seminar will be recorded and uploaded to YouTube afterward.
